Lexmark MX310dn error 880.00: Toner Fault

The Lexmark MX310dn error 880.00 appears when the system fails to correctly identify the installed toner cartridge. This common error follows a refill or replacement and is typically related to a communication fault between the cartridge chip and the printer's reader.

Common causes

  • 1Dirty toner chip or grease from fingerprints.
  • 2Cartridge improperly inserted into the printer guides.
  • 3Defective toner chip (especially in remanufactured cartridges).
  • 4Bent or damaged internal reader metal contacts.

Solutions

Quick Diagnosis

If you just changed the toner, the most likely cause is that the cartridge is not fully seated or the metal chip contacts are dirty. Check if the error disappears after moving the cartridge firmly inwards.

Step-by-Step Solution

  1. Remove Cartridge: Open the front cover and carefully remove the toner cartridge to prevent spills.
  2. Clean Contacts: Clean the cartridge's gold chips with a dry, lint-free cloth.
  3. Reinstall: Insert the cartridge again until you hear a firm click indicating its correct position.

Prevention and Maintenance

Handle cartridges by the ends, avoiding touching the side electronic chip. Store consumables in a cool place away from direct sunlight.

When to Call a Technician

If the error 880.00 persists after trying a new original cartridge, the printer's chip reader may be defective.

Equipment Technical Data

  • Technology: Monochrome laser
  • Toner System: Separable cartridge and imaging unit
  • Compatible Consumables: Lexmark 60F
  • Connectivity: Ethernet, USB
  • Recommended Use: Small office
